10 Tips for Maximising Your Storage Unit

30th September 2024

Cardboard boxes with the Easystore Self Storage logo on them
Self storage units are a fantastic solution for managing excess belongings, seasonal items, or business inventory. However, to get the most out of your storage space, it’s essential to organise and pack it efficiently.

Here are some tips and tricks to maximise your storage space effectively.

1. Plan ahead

Before you start packing, take some time to plan. Make a list of all the items you intend to store and categorise them. This will help you determine the size of the storage unit you need and how to organise it. Planning ahead can save you time and effort in the long run.

2. Use the same boxes

Using boxes of the same size makes stacking easier and more stable. It also helps in utilising the vertical space in your storage unit more efficiently. Make sure to label each box clearly with its contents and the room it belongs to – this will make it much easier to find items when you need them.

3. Invest in shelving

Shelving units can be a game-changer when it comes to maximizing storage space. By using shelves, you can take advantage of the vertical space in your unit, keeping items off the floor and organised. This is especially useful for smaller items or boxes that you need to access frequently.

4. Disassemble large items

If you have large furniture or equipment, consider disassembling them before storing. This can save a significant amount of space and make it easier to pack your unit. Keep all screws and small parts in labeled bags and tape them to the corresponding furniture pieces to avoid losing them.

5. Vacuum-sealed bags are your friend

For items like clothing, bedding, and other soft goods, vacuum-sealed bags can be a great space-saving solution. These bags compress the items, reducing their volume and protecting them from dust and moisture.

6. Store things you need the most at the front

Think about how often you’ll need to access certain items and store them accordingly. Place items you might need to retrieve frequently near the front of the unit. Seasonal items or things you won’t need for a while can go towards the back.

7. Create a map and take photos

Once your unit is packed, create a map or diagram showing where everything is located. This can be a simple sketch or a detailed inventory list. Having a map will save you time and frustration when you need to find specific items. Take photos of your unit so you don’t have to go there just to know what you have there.

8. Use protective covers

Protect your belongings by using covers for furniture and other large items. This will help prevent dust accumulation and potential damage. For delicate items, consider using bubble wrap or packing paper for extra protection.

9. Maximise vertical space

Don’t forget to use the height of your storage unit to your advantage. Stack boxes and items as high as safely possible, but ensure that heavier items are at the bottom and lighter ones on top. This will help you make the most of the available space.

10. Regularly reassess your storage needs

Periodically check your storage unit to reassess your needs. You might find that some items are no longer necessary, or you could reorganise to create more space. Keeping your storage unit tidy and organised will make it easier to manage over time.
